The story of Ann "Nancy" Slater began in 1773 in Edgefield Dist., SC. In 1850, Ann "Nancy" Slater resided in Clarke, Alabama, USA. Ann "Nancy" Slater married John Stringer, William Leander Thornton, and had children including Eli S Thornton, George Stringer, John W Thornton, Martha Ann Patsy Stringer, William Stringer. Ann "Nancy" Slater passed away in 1850 in Clarke County, Alabama, United States of America.
